Not according to PGC regs pertaining to SGL use:

-It is unlawful to ride a non-motorized vehicle, conveyance or animal (on SGLs)from the last Saturday in September, until the third Saturday in January, andprior to one hour after close of lawful shooting hoursfor spring turkey season, from the second Saturday inApril, through the last Saturday in May (inclusive), exceptonSundays....OR while lawfully engaged in hunting, trapping or fishing.

-It is unlawful to ride a non-motorized vehicle, conveyance or animal on roads open to foot travel only.

-It is unlawful to engage in any activity or event involving more than 10 persons, which may conflict with with the intended purposes or use of property, or poses a potential environmentalor safety problem.

There is also a section that says you cannot be on SGLs from Nov. 15 to Dec. 15 (inclusive), when not engagedin lawful hunting or trapping, without wearing 250 square inches ofFO, etc, except on Sundays or while using an SGL shooting range.
